Iron Orean overview ScienceDirect Topics

Three potential sources (from the ores sinter or scrap) of naturally occurring radionuclides in the slag are discussed. Iron ores due to their geochemical properties scavenge radionuclides and heavy metals resulting in only trace levels of uranium in the main raw materials for ironmaking iron ore and coke ranging of 20–30 Bq/kg and 5 Bq/kg for limestone (Cooper 2005).

BENEFICIATION OF IRON

 · Iron ore sample found is a part of banded iron ore formation. Hematite and goethite are major constituents of iron ore samples. Hematite in the ore sample occurs as specularite with inter granular micropore spaces. Goethite is profuse and occurs as colloform product in cavities in addition with the weaker bedding planes.

iron processingIron making Britannica

 · iron processingiron processingIron making The primary objective of iron making is to release iron from chemical combination with oxygen and since the blast furnace is much the most efficient process it receives the most attention here. Alternative methods known as direct reduction are used in over a score of countries but less than 5 percent of iron is made this way.

Iron Tailings ReProcessing Technology A New Weapon for

 · Usually according to different ore properties different tailings treatment and recovery processes will be used for iron tailings reprocessing. In general iron tailings reprocessing mainly includes the process of magnetic separation gravity separation flotation and combined separation methods.

Investigation of Efficiency of Magnetic Separation

 · In this research the efficiency of magnetic separation methods for processing of a lowgrade iron pigments ore (red ochre) has been studied. Based on the mineralogical analyses (XRD) thin section and polish studies the reserve is an iron sedimentary deposit with an average Fe grade of The most valuable minerals are Hematite and Goethite and main gangue minerals are Calcite and Quartz.

Iron ProcessingFEECO International Inc.

Our heavyduty iron ore balling drums are relied on by some of the industry s top producers to process iron ore fines into pellets for the steelmaking process. The use of a disc pelletizer is a popular alternative approach to pelletizing iron ore fines as this offers more control over pellet size and produces a more refined pellet product.
